Transaction 6ec4c7fa60b4a2931fccf71cc659d7f804da314f79b481d1a2cc176be7b31bf2
1 Input
1 Output
-
6ec4c7fa60b4a2931fccf71cc659d7f804da314f79b481d1a2cc176be7b31bf2:0
- value
- 98790
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b58943851fee0dac82163c2892ee2db582bf6f9b OP_EQUAL
- address
- 3JEtfWyWNLZDuuvFmXdnxx54QWcvTaoWCS